Output f25c75d66609228f1643e75aa48986c205739c55c5e928bfa84f01c61151e245:0

value
1261000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3bd86cd7b3f1938606a8855578942e47c0be9d OP_EQUAL
address
32ohiyfS6SQokywqYbHpqnhfMmHKesXYTQ
transaction
f25c75d66609228f1643e75aa48986c205739c55c5e928bfa84f01c61151e245
confirmations
267758
spent
true